Output 973388d67f06259c9202c73a9e00673c07b85d51b54390c4db5113938cd686fb:3

value
12078267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 605e692a46e881b433b835ff617f7b7aac090eb5 OP_EQUAL
address
MGgiCd7KpxcH4ReTXoePF4wjbhmicsDBCz
transaction
973388d67f06259c9202c73a9e00673c07b85d51b54390c4db5113938cd686fb
spent
true